539 * This lookup could return termcap data, which we do not want. We are
540 * looking for compiled (binary) terminfo data.
542 * cgetent uses a two-level lookup. On the first it uses the given
543 * name to return a record containing only the aliases for an entry.
544 * On the second (using that list of aliases as a key), it returns the
545 * content of the terminal description. We expect second lookup to
546 * return data beginning with the same set of aliases.
548 * For compiled terminfo, the list of aliases in the second case will
549 * be null-terminated. A termcap entry will not be, and will run on
550 * into the description. So we can easily distinguish between the two
551 * (source/binary) by checking the lengths.
